PUFFED SLEEVE CARDI

SKILL LEVEL

WHAT YOU'LL NEED

Yarn

3 (3, 4, 4, 4) balls 50gm
Peter Pan DK moondust
3 buttons

Needles and tools


3.25mm knitting needles
4mm knitting needles
Stitch holders

Tension

22 sts by 31 rows to 10 cm over St st on 4mm needles.

MEASUREMENTS

WORKING PATTERN BACK

Using 3.25mm needles, cast on 59 (67, 75, 83, 91) sts.

Row 1: RS – P1, * K1, P1, rep from * to end.

Row 2: K1, * P1, K1, rep from * to end.

These 2 rows form rib. Change to 4mm needles.
